Output b26c1a4c9fc634b4d5831074121e4cb01f2918b75f995b50628b6efb5d7124d4:1

value
6965669405206
script pubkey
OP_0 OP_PUSHBYTES_20 743aa351da233570833173b6f729b8684e6af029
address
tb1qwsa2x5w6yv6hpqe3wwm0w2dcdp8x4upfudultp
transaction
b26c1a4c9fc634b4d5831074121e4cb01f2918b75f995b50628b6efb5d7124d4
confirmations
182412
spent
true